I was amazed to discover Deen City Farm just down the road from my house last year, and have been keen to find out more about it ever since.

It’s a riding school as well as a farm, with some lovely ‘growing gardens’.  The site used to be used as a dumping ground, so the existing soil is contaminated.  However they have cleverly got round this by using raised beds, and other planters such as shopping trolleys and old baths.

In addition to the growing gardens, the farm also has a fair amount of livestock, including an aviary, small animals enclosure, and more traditional breeds.

Ben Cheetham is the project manager for Deen City Farm.  He was kind enough to invite me to the farm for an interview for another Big Smoke, Green Living podcast.  (Flighty – this one is one cup of tea and two biscuits long I think).
